With almost a week left until Fujifilm will announce its first weather-sealed X-series interchangeable lens camera, the X-T1, the company created a new teaser website where it will probably introduce the camera on January 28.

The new X-T1 will feature the “best EVF on the market,” as an anonymous source puts it, and will come with a weather-sealed body, faster AF than X-E2, UHS-II SD card support and other great features that you can read about in our previous article.

According to PhotographyBay, an anonymous tipster says that Fujifilm is planning to reveal the successor of X-Pro1, the X-Pro2 mirrorless camera, at the Photokina imaging fair in September.

For the moment, there aren't any details about this new X-series camera but, at the same time, it's unlikely that Fujifilm will wait until then to introduce it. It's possible that we will see the X-Pro2 next month at CP+ in Yokohama, Japan.
